    ABOUT THE COMPANY

    The new NCBA has harnessed the power of both NIC and CBA to create a bank that brings together the best of both worlds — from cutting edge mobile banking to good old-fashioned relationship management; from scalable business banking to financial services that grow as your business does; from best-in-class choice of products to investment solutions tailored to your specific needs.

    JOB SUMMARY

    To provide leadership to the regional teams to Acquire, Grow & Retain B2C customers (Merchants).
